Table 3
Return to sport after TKR, data extracted from studies included in the review (10 studies).
Study | Study design | Mean follow-up | Study population | RTS | Time to RTS | Mean post-operative UCLA | UCLA progression | Satisfied and very satisfied |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Bauman et al. [16] | Cross-sectional survey | 36.6 month | 184 patients | – | – | 6 | – | – |
Bonnin et al. [24] | Cross-sectional survey | 44 month | 347 patients | 56% group <75 yo | – | – | – | 83% |
Bradbury et al. [14] | Cross-sectional survey | 5 years | 160 patients | 77% | – | – | – | – |
Chang et al. [10] | Retrospective study | 2 years | 369 patients | 76% | – | 4.8 | +0.3 | – |
Chatterji et al. [15] | Cross-sectional survey | Between 1 and 2 years | 144 patients | 75% | – | – | – | – |
Dahm et al. [3] | Cross-sectional survey | 5.7 years | 1206 patients | – | – | 7.1 | – | 91% |
Hopper and Leach [13] | Cross-sectional survey | 21.6 months | 76 patients | 63% | – | – | – | 80.3% |
Noble et al. [8] | Cross-sectional survey | >1 year | 253 patients | – | – | – | – | 75% |
Witjes et al. [18] | Systematic review | Variable | 18 studies | 36–89% | 12 weeks | 4.6–5.9 | – | – |
Wylde et al. [17] | Cross-sectional survey | >3 years | 866 patients | 73% | – | – | – | – |
